# Garrowgate occupancy feed — env for the collector service.
# Reviewer notes: the feed polls gate sensors at the Velmora deck every 20s;
# payloads are signed, transport is TLS only, no PII is carried.
# Rotation cadence is quarterly; last rotation logged in the ops journal.
# The upstream API credential for the sensor gateway is set on the next line.

sealed setting: LEDGER_TOKEN5=bcca1

Legacy customers on pre-2019 tariffs will see a structured price increase next quarter: eight percent on standard plans, five on fixed-term. Churn modeling by the Westholt team projects a three percent attrition ceiling. Retention offers are authorized for accounts exceeding five years' tenure; approval sits with branch finance leads. Communications packs ship next week. No exceptions without head-office sign-off. Hold all media queries. The confidential addendum on business plans follows immediately below.

board note of kageg-bahof: The renewal with Holwynax Holdings closes at $2 million a year, 5 percent below the last contract. Project Ulaath slips by two quarters because of the supplier delay.

# Break-Glass: Catalog Cache Invalidation

Scope: the Pinrow product catalog at Veldstone Retail. If stale prices persist after a purge and the Hollowmere invalidation queue is wedged, use break-glass to flush the edge tier directly. Contractors: get verbal sign-off from the catalog lead first. Steps: open the Hollowmere admin shell, select emergency-flush, confirm the tenant, and run it once — repeated flushes thrash the origin. Access is logged and expires after 20 minutes. Unseal the admin shell with the passphrase below.

recovery phrase for kahop-tajog: istix-casvan